/// Packs the AMF object to a std::string for transfer over the network.
/// If the object is a container type, this function will call itself recursively and contain all contents.
/// Tip: When sending multiple AMF objects in one go, put them in a single AMF::AMF0_DDV_CONTAINER for easy transfer.
std::string AMF::Object::Pack(){
  std::string r = "";
  //check for string/longstring conversion
  if ((myType == AMF::AMF0_STRING) && (strval.size() > 0xFFFF)){myType = AMF::AMF0_LONGSTRING;}
  //skip output of DDV container types, they do not exist. Only output their contents.
  if (myType != AMF::AMF0_DDV_CONTAINER){r += myType;}
  //output the properly formatted AMF0 data stream for this object's contents.
  switch (myType){
    case AMF::AMF0_NUMBER:
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+7); r += *(((char*)&numval)+6);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+5); r += *(((char*)&numval)+4);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+3); r += *(((char*)&numval)+2);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+1); r += *(((char*)&numval));
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_DATE:
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+7); r += *(((char*)&numval)+6);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+5); r += *(((char*)&numval)+4);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+3); r += *(((char*)&numval)+2);
      r += *(((char*)&numval)+1); r += *(((char*)&numval));
      r += (char)0;//timezone always 0
      r += (char)0;//timezone always 0
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_BOOL:
      r += (char)numval;
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_STRING:
      r += strval.size() / 256;
      r += strval.size() % 256;
      r += strval;
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_LONGSTRING:
    case AMF::AMF0_XMLDOC://is always a longstring
      r += strval.size() / (256*256*256);
      r += strval.size() / (256*256);
      r += strval.size() / 256;
      r += strval.size() % 256;
      r += strval;
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_TYPED_OBJ:
      r += Indice().size() / 256;
      r += Indice().size() % 256;
      r += Indice();
      //is an object, with the classname first
    case AMF::AMF0_OBJECT:
      if (contents.size() > 0){
        for (std::vector<AMF::Object>::iterator it = contents.begin(); it != contents.end(); it++){
          r += it->Indice().size() / 256;
          r += it->Indice().size() % 256;
          r += it->Indice();
          r += it->Pack();
        }
      }
      r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)9;
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_MOVIECLIP:
    case AMF::AMF0_OBJ_END:
    case AMF::AMF0_UPGRADE:
    case AMF::AMF0_NULL:
    case AMF::AMF0_UNDEFINED:
    case AMF::AMF0_RECORDSET:
    case AMF::AMF0_UNSUPPORTED:
      //no data to add
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_REFERENCE:
      r += (char)((int)numval / 256);
      r += (char)((int)numval % 256);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_ECMA_ARRAY:{
      int arrlen = 0;
      if (contents.size() > 0){
        arrlen = contents.size();
        r += arrlen / (256*256*256); r += arrlen / (256*256); r += arrlen / 256; r += arrlen % 256;
        for (std::vector<AMF::Object>::iterator it = contents.begin(); it != contents.end(); it++){
          r += it->Indice().size() / 256;
          r += it->Indice().size() % 256;
          r += it->Indice();
          r += it->Pack();
        }
      }else{
        r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)0;
      }
      r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)9;
      } break;
    case AMF::AMF0_STRICT_ARRAY:{
      int arrlen = 0;
      if (contents.size() > 0){
        arrlen = contents.size();
        r += arrlen / (256*256*256); r += arrlen / (256*256); r += arrlen / 256; r += arrlen % 256;
        for (std::vector<AMF::Object>::iterator it = contents.begin(); it != contents.end(); it++){
          r += it->Pack();
        }
      }else{
        r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)0; r += (char)0;
      }
    } break;
    case AMF::AMF0_DDV_CONTAINER://only send contents
      if (contents.size() > 0){
        for (std::vector<AMF::Object>::iterator it = contents.begin(); it != contents.end(); it++){
          r += it->Pack();
        }
      }
      break;
  }
  return r;
};//pack

/// Parses a single AMF0 type - used recursively by the AMF::parse() functions.
/// This function updates i every call with the new position in the data.
/// \param data The raw data to parse.
/// \param len The size of the raw data.
/// \param i Current parsing position in the raw data.
/// \param name Indice name for any new object created.
/// \returns A single AMF::Object, parsed from the raw data.
AMF::Object AMF::parseOne(const unsigned char *& data, unsigned int &len, unsigned int &i, std::string name){
  std::string tmpstr;
  unsigned int tmpi = 0;
  unsigned char tmpdbl[8];
  double *d;// hack to work around strict aliasing
  #if DEBUG >= 10
  fprintf(stderr, "Note: AMF type %hhx found. %i bytes left\n", data[i], len-i);
  #endif
  switch (data[i]){
    case AMF::AMF0_NUMBER:
      tmpdbl[7] = data[i+1];
      tmpdbl[6] = data[i+2];
      tmpdbl[5] = data[i+3];
      tmpdbl[4] = data[i+4];
      tmpdbl[3] = data[i+5];
      tmpdbl[2] = data[i+6];
      tmpdbl[1] = data[i+7];
      tmpdbl[0] = data[i+8];
      i+=9;//skip 8(a double)+1 forwards
      d = (double*)tmpdbl;
      return AMF::Object(name, *d, AMF::AMF0_NUMBER);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_DATE:
      tmpdbl[7] = data[i+1];
      tmpdbl[6] = data[i+2];
      tmpdbl[5] = data[i+3];
      tmpdbl[4] = data[i+4];
      tmpdbl[3] = data[i+5];
      tmpdbl[2] = data[i+6];
      tmpdbl[1] = data[i+7];
      tmpdbl[0] = data[i+8];
      i+=11;//skip 8(a double)+1+timezone(2) forwards
      d = (double*)tmpdbl;
      return AMF::Object(name, *d, AMF::AMF0_DATE);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_BOOL:
      i+=2;//skip bool+1 forwards
      if (data[i-1] == 0){
        return AMF::Object(name, (double)0, AMF::AMF0_BOOL);
      }else{
        return AMF::Object(name, (double)1, AMF::AMF0_BOOL);
      }
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_REFERENCE:
      tmpi = data[i+1]*256+data[i+2];//get the ref number value as a double
      i+=3;//skip ref+1 forwards
      return AMF::Object(name, (double)tmpi, AMF::AMF0_REFERENCE);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_XMLDOC:
      tmpi = data[i+1]*256*256*256+data[i+2]*256*256+data[i+3]*256+data[i+4];//set tmpi to UTF-8-long length
      t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
      tmpstr.append((const char *)data+i+5,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
      i += tmpi + 5;//skip length+size+1 forwards
      return AMF::Object(name, tmpstr, AMF::AMF0_XMLDOC);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_LONGSTRING:
      tmpi = data[i+1]*256*256*256+data[i+2]*256*256+data[i+3]*256+data[i+4];//set tmpi to UTF-8-long length
      t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
      tmpstr.append((const char *)data+i+5,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
      i += tmpi + 5;//skip length+size+1 forwards
      return AMF::Object(name, tmpstr, AMF::AMF0_LONGSTRING);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_STRING:
      tmpi = data[i+1]*256+data[i+2];//set tmpi to UTF-8 length
      t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
      tmpstr.append((const char *)data+i+3,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
      i += tmpi + 3;//skip length+size+1 forwards
      return AMF::Object(name, tmpstr, AMF::AMF0_STRING);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_NULL:
    case AMF::AMF0_UNDEFINED:
    case AMF::AMF0_UNSUPPORTED:
      ++i;
      return AMF::Object(name, (double)0, (AMF::obj0type)data[i-1]);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F0_OBJECT:{
      ++i;
      AMF::Object ret(name, AMF::AMF0_OBJECT);
      while (data[i] + data[i+1] != 0){//while not encountering 0x0000 (we assume 0x000009)
        tmpi = data[i]*256+data[i+1];//set tmpi to the UTF-8 length
        t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
        tmpstr.append((const char*)data+i+2,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
        i += tmpi + 2;//skip length+size forwards
        ret.addContent(AMF::parseOne(data, len, i, tmpstr));//add content, recursively parsed, updating i, setting indice to tmpstr
      }
      i += 3;//skip 0x000009
      return ret;
      } break;
    case AMF::AMF0_TYPED_OBJ:{
      ++i;
      tmpi = data[i]*256+data[i+1];//set tmpi to the UTF-8 length
      t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
      tmpstr.append((const char*)data+i+2,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
      AMF::Object ret(tmpstr, AMF::AMF0_TYPED_OBJ);//the object is not named "name" but tmpstr
      while (data[i] + data[i+1] != 0){//while not encountering 0x0000 (we assume 0x000009)
        tmpi = data[i]*256+data[i+1];//set tmpi to the UTF-8 length
        t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
        tmpstr.append((const char*)data+i+2,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
        i += tmpi + 2;//skip length+size forwards
        ret.addContent(AMF::parseOne(data, len, i, tmpstr));//add content, recursively parsed, updating i, setting indice to tmpstr
      }
      i += 3;//skip 0x000009
      return ret;
    } break;
    case AMF::AMF0_ECMA_ARRAY:{
      ++i;
      AMF::Object ret(name, AMF::AMF0_ECMA_ARRAY);
      i += 4;//ignore the array length, we re-calculate it
      while (data[i] + data[i+1] != 0){//while not encountering 0x0000 (we assume 0x000009)
        tmpi = data[i]*256+data[i+1];//set tmpi to the UTF-8 length
        tmpstr.clear();//clean tmpstr, just to be sure
        tmpstr.append((const char*)data+i+2, (size_t)tmpi);//add the string data
        i += tmpi + 2;//skip length+size forwards
        ret.addContent(AMF::parseOne(data, len, i, tmpstr));//add content, recursively parsed, updating i, setting indice to tmpstr
      }
      i += 3;//skip 0x000009
      return ret;
    } break;
    case AMF::AMF0_STRICT_ARRAY:{
      AMF::Object ret(name, AMF::AMF0_STRICT_ARRAY);
      tmpi = data[i+1]*256*256*256+data[i+2]*256*256+data[i+3]*256+data[i+4];//set tmpi to array length
      i += 5;//skip size+1 forwards
      while (tmpi > 0){//while not done parsing array
        ret.addContent(AMF::parseOne(data, len, i, "arrVal"));//add content, recursively parsed, updating i
        --tmpi;
      }
      return ret;
    } break;
  }
  #if DEBUG >= 2
  fprintf(stderr, "Error: Unimplemented AMF type %hhx - returning.\n", data[i]);
  #endif
  return AMF::Object("error", AMF::AMF0_DDV_CONTAINER);
}//parseOne

/// Parses a single AMF3 type - used recursively by the AMF::parse3() functions.
/// This function updates i every call with the new position in the data.
/// \param data The raw data to parse.
/// \param len The size of the raw data.
/// \param i Current parsing position in the raw data.
/// \param name Indice name for any new object created.
/// \returns A single AMF::Object3, parsed from the raw data.
AMF::Object3 AMF::parseOne3(const unsigned char *& data, unsigned int &len, unsigned int &i, std::string name){
  std::string tmpstr;
  unsigned int tmpi = 0;
  unsigned int arrsize = 0;
  unsigned char tmpdbl[8];
  double *d;// hack to work around strict aliasing
  #if DEBUG >= 10
  fprintf(stderr, "Note: AMF3 type %hhx found. %i bytes left\n", data[i], len-i);
  #endif
  switch (data[i]){
    case AMF::AMF3_UNDEFINED:
    case AMF::AMF3_NULL:
    case AMF::AMF3_FALSE:
    case AMF::AMF3_TRUE:
      ++i;
      return AMF::Object3(name, (AMF::obj3type)data[i-1]);
      break;
    case AMF::AMF3_INTEGER:
      if (data[i+1] < 0x80){
        tmpi = data[i+1];
        i+=2;
      }else{
        tmpi = (data[i+1] & 0x7F) << 7;//strip the upper bit, shift 7 up.
        if (data[i+2] < 0x80){
          tmpi |= data[i+2];
          i+=3;
        }else{
          tmpi = (tmpi | (data[i+2] & 0x7F)) << 7;//strip the upper bit, shift 7 up.
          if (data[i+3] < 0x80){
            tmpi |= data[i+3];
            i+=4;
          }else{
            tmpi = (tmpi | (data[i+3] & 0x7F)) << 8;//strip the upper bit, shift 7 up.
            tmpi |= data[i+4];
            i+=5;
          }
        }
      }
      tmpi = (tmpi << 3) >> 3;//fix sign bit
      return AMF::Object3(name, (int)tmpi, AMF::AMF3_INTEGER);
      break;
